Description

The wire installation frame of a kind of dome or arc or slope use
[technical field]
The present invention relates to a kind of electric wire, cable bearer, especially relate to the wire installation frame that a kind of dome or arc or slope use.
[background technique]
Known, the electric wire of electrical network netting twine, cable is in erection, need through bridge, vacant lot, river, mountain valley, building etc., especially through bridge and building, adopting tripod to be attached to bottom bridge or on building is a kind of way of routine, so not only can save a lot of electric pole, and cost can be made significantly to reduce, owing to being subject to the constraint of design itself bottom bridge with building, there will be and belong to dome type inclined-plane or arc shaped surface or slope, make substantially to set up conventional tripod, the inclined-plane of external drum cannot be installed especially, even it is also very unstable for having set up tripod, namely arc surface only has an immovable point, very large hidden danger is brought to safety.
[summary of the invention]
In order to overcome the deficiency in background technique, the present invention discloses the wire installation frame that a kind of dome or arc or slope use, the wire installation frame that dome of the present invention or arc or slope use is connected with two identical or different inclined-planes on the face on dome or arc or slope respectively by two wall connecting bases, guarantee that angle bar is in level and installs, the level achieving electric wire on later stage porcelain vase is installed and stability; The present invention breaches the use narrow limitation of existing tripod structure.

[embodiment]
Can explain the present invention in more detail by the following examples, disclose object of the present invention and be intended to protect all changes and improvements in the scope of the invention, the present invention is not limited to the following examples;
The wire installation frame of the dome by reference to the accompanying drawings described in 1,2 or 3 or arc or slope use, comprise angle bar 2, wall connecting base, bolt 4, nut 6 and wall EXPANSION ANCHOR BOLTS 10 that double end connects bearing diagonal 7, two same structures, side plate one end of described angle bar 2 is provided with extension piece, perforation 5 is provided with in the end of extension piece, the upper board of angle bar 2 is provided with multiple porcelain vase pole mounting hole 1, and the side plate of angle bar 2 is interval with a plurality of position regulation hole 3, the two end part connecting bearing diagonal 7 in double end are respectively equipped with perforation 5, described arbitrary wall connecting base comprises perpendicular connecting plate 8 and is connected transverse slat 9 with wall, wall connects the middle part of transverse slat 9 and one end of perpendicular connecting plate 8 is fixedly connected to form "T"-shaped structure, perpendicular connecting plate 8 both sides connecting transverse slat 9 at wall are respectively equipped with perforation 5, and the other end of described perpendicular connecting plate 8 is provided with perforation 5, the wall of two wall connecting bases connects transverse slat 9 and is fixed on bottom bridge or on building respectively by wall EXPANSION ANCHOR BOLTS 10, wherein the perforation 5 of one of two wall connecting bases perpendicular connecting plate 8 is by bolt 4, nut 6 is hinged fixing with the perforation 5 on angle bar 2 extension piece, the perforation 5 of the perpendicular connecting plate 8 of another wall connecting base is by bolt 4, nut 6 is connected bearing diagonal 7 one end perforation 5 with double end is hinged fixing, double end connects the perforation 5 of bearing diagonal 7 the other end by bolt 4, one of them position regulation hole 3 that nut 6 and angle bar 2 side plate are arranged is connected and fixed, make described angle bar 2 in horizontal positioned.
The wire installation frame of dome of the present invention or arc or slope use, the 2 a kind of mounting types provided by reference to the accompanying drawings, wall vertically add the top and the bottom gradient is installed of the present invention time, one of them wall of two wall connecting bases is connected transverse slat 9 to be fixed on gradient face, bottom by wall EXPANSION ANCHOR BOLTS 10, the wall of another wall connecting base connects transverse slat 9 and is fixed on the vertical surface of wall by wall EXPANSION ANCHOR BOLTS 10, wherein fixing wall connecting base on the vertical plane erects the perforation 5 of connecting plate 8 by bolt 4, nut 6 is connected with the perforation 5 of angle bar 2 extension piece, the wall connecting base be fixed on gradient face, bottom erects the perforation 5 of connecting plate 8 by bolt 4, nut 6 is connected bearing diagonal 7 one end perforation 5 with double end connects, double end connects the perforation 5 of bearing diagonal 7 the other end by bolt 4, nut 6 be adjusted to the 2-in-1 suitable position regulation hole 3 of horizontal angle bar and be connected and just can, wherein porcelain vase can be arranged on the porcelain vase pole mounting hole 1 of angle bar 2 in advance, then install electric wiring.
The 3 another kind of mounting types provided by reference to the accompanying drawings, wall vertically add upper inclined surface is installed of the present invention time, one of them wall of two wall connecting bases is connected transverse slat 9 to be fixed on wall vertical surface by wall EXPANSION ANCHOR BOLTS 10, the wall of another wall connecting base connects transverse slat 9 and is fixed in the upper inclined surface of wall by wall EXPANSION ANCHOR BOLTS 10, wherein fixing wall connecting base on the vertical plane erects the perforation 5 of connecting plate 8 by bolt 4, nut 6 is connected with the perforation 5 of angle bar 2 extension piece, the wall connecting base be fixed in upper inclined surface erects the perforation 5 of connecting plate 8 by bolt 4, nut 6 is connected bearing diagonal 7 one end perforation 5 with double end connects, double end connects the perforation 5 of bearing diagonal 7 the other end by bolt 4, nut 6 be adjusted to the 2-in-1 suitable position regulation hole 3 of horizontal angle bar and be connected and just can install electric wiring.
As long as the present invention possesses the face of the different gradient of two equal angular in actual applications, just can install the present invention, the present invention especially adapts to the stringing that bridge lower vertical beam adds the places such as structure in upper inclined surface, building end face bottom, slope.
